In the Terminal app on your Mac, enter the complete pathname of the tool’s executable file, followed by any needed arguments, then press … Web2 dagen geleden · You can invoke a client from a command-line terminal by issuing an adb command. A daemon (adbd), which runs commands on a device. The daemon runs as a background process on each device. A server, which manages communication between the client and the daemon. The server runs as a background process on your development …

Finally, it is important to realize that when running an executable file from an MS … WebHere are the steps to do so: Open a MySQL client, such as the MySQL command line tool or phpMyAdmin. Run the following command to see a list of running queries: SHOW PROCESSLIST; 3. Identify the Idof the query you want to stop. 4. Run the following command to stop the query: KILL query_id;

In … Web12 jan. 2024 · A command line interface (CLI) is a computer program that runs on text-based inputs to execute different tasks. Instead of pointing and clicking with a mouse, it receives single-line commands that interact with system elements like file management.
